Webber731 Posted June 12, 2020 Author Report Share Posted June 12, 2020 (edited) No, I use the common version of Enpass Can you tell me how to restore Enpass through a backup copy (the path to this copy is needed) Edited June 13, 2020 by Webber731 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Garima Singh Posted June 15, 2020 Report Share Posted June 15, 2020 Hey @Webber731 Sorry for the trouble you are going through. To restore the backup file, please follow the below steps- Open Enpass ---> Settings ---> Vaults > Create a new Vault by clicking on “+“ ---> Click on ‘Local storage’ under Backup file --> Select the location and folder of file(which is saved locally) --> Select the vault which you wish to restore and click on Continue --> Enter master password (same you using previously)--> Tap on 'Continue'. Backup file is exist in the given location: C:\Users\XXXXXX\AppData\Local\Packages\SinewSoftwareSystems.EnpassPasswordManager_fwdy0m65qb6h2\LocalState\Backups (where XXXXXX is your user account name of the system) Thanks.
